1, RUPERT ROAD, BINGHAM, NOTTINGHAM, NG13 8EZ - £217,500

1 RUPERT ROAD is a large extended detached house of 130m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975. It was last sold for £217,500 in August 2009, which was around 14% below the average August 2009 detached price in the Rushcliffe local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2015,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Rushcliffe local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 1 RUPERT ROAD sales from July 2000 and August 2009 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2000 sale was for 12%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 12% below the HPI over time, until the August 2009 sale, where it falls to 14%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 14% below the HPI.

1 RUPERT ROAD: Plot and Title Map

1 RUPERT 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.089 of an acre, or 359m². The below map shows the location of 1 RUPERT 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 1 RUPERT 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
